Why commercial sites need properly constructed hardstand areas

Hardstandings provide essential prepared ground surfaces where vehicles, machinery and materials need stable support. Unlike grass or unmade ground that becomes muddy and rutted, a quality hardstand maintains level access whatever the weather brings. Commercial premises depend on functional hardstandings to keep operations moving smoothly, whether that means delivery lorries accessing loading bays, staff parking vehicles safely, or storing equipment outdoors without ground damage affecting your premises.

Matching hardstanding design to actual usage demands

Not every hardstand needs identical construction specifications. Car park hardstandings serving standard vehicles require different base depths and surface materials compared to hardstand areas accommodating heavy goods vehicles or loaded forklifts. We calculate the weight loading your hardstanding must support, factor in traffic frequency and turning movements, then specify base thickness and surface type accordingly. Overdoing hardstand construction wastes your budget, whilst underspecifying leads to premature failure and expensive reconstruction. Hard standing areas are sections of ground finished with a durable, load-bearing surface, concrete, tarmac, compacted aggregate or block paving, that can support vehicles, machinery and stored materials. Unlike grass or bare earth, a hard standing stays firm and usable in all weather, preventing mud, ruts and standing water on commercial and agricultural sites.

Hard standing means an area of ground laid with a hard, stable surface designed to carry weight. You may see it written as "hard standing", "hardstanding" or "hardstand", they all mean the same thing. The term is used across the UK for commercial parking, loading bays, equipment storage and site access routes that need a solid, all-weather surface instead of soft ground.

In construction, a hardstand (or hard standing) is a prepared, paved area built to bear heavy loads such as plant, lorries or materials. It is constructed in layers, an excavated, compacted sub-base topped with concrete, tarmac or aggregate, so the surface resists settlement, rutting and damage under constant use.

Many commercial hard standing projects fall under permitted development, but planning permission may be needed for larger areas, non-permeable surfaces that drain onto a public highway, or sites in conservation areas or close to boundaries.
